Central Park Library adding Sundays beginning January 26, 2025
*Central Park Library Adding Sunday Hours*
Starting Jan. 26, 2025, Santa Clara City Library will be expanding its services to include Sunday hours at the Central Park Library from 1-5 p.m. The community to be able to access books and materials in many languages, support and technology resources in the tech center, the seed library, genealogy and local history resources, the children and teen areas and the popular study rooms. Holiday Tree Collection
*Recycle Your Holiday Tree*
Residential holiday trees will be collected curbside on regular garbage collection days during the week of Jan. 6-10. Remove all ornaments, tinsel, nails and the stand. *After Jan. 10, cut up your tree and place the pieces in your green yard trimmings cart. _Flocked_ trees should be cut up and placed in your garbage cart.* For more information on holiday tree recycling and set-out instructions, visit *SantaClaraCA.gov/CleanSC [ https://www.santaclaraca.gov/our-city/departments-g-z/public-works/environmental-programs/residential-garbage-recycling ]* or call the Dept. of Public Works at 408-615-3080.
New California “Daylighting Law” (AB 413) to go into effect January 1, 2025
*California’s New Daylighting Law Goes into Effect*
California’s new “Daylighting Law” has gone into effect as of Jan. 1, 2025. Approved by the Governor on Oct. 10, 2023, Assembly Bill 413 (AB 413) was created to enhance pedestrian safety by prohibiting vehicles from parking within 20 feet of marked and unmarked crosswalks, and within 15 feet of crosswalks that have curb extensions. These parking restrictions are designed to improve the visibility of both moving vehicles and pedestrians, helping reduce collisions.
Per the new law, the Santa Clara Police Department (SCPD) can begin enforcement on Jan. 1, 2025, but SCPD is considering utilizing the month of January 2025 as a grace period where the focus is on education versus enforcement. Under this law, a ticketed violation is $53. Since this is a State Law, it is in effect whether there are red curbs/no parking signage or not. However, the City of Santa Clara plans to install new red curb markings or no parking signage at select higher priority pedestrian areas. Installation will be done in phases and will focus on marked crosswalks with heavy pedestrian activity or uncontrolled crosswalks (i.e. striped pedestrian crossings where motorists do not have a traffic control device such as a stop sign, traffic signal, or flashing beacon controlling their movement through the crosswalk).
15 MPH School Zone
*School Zone 15 MPH Speed Limits*
The City of Santa Clara’s Department of Public Works is working on an initiative to reduce speed limits on certain streets around schools from 25 to 15 miles per hour (mph) when children are present. This proposed 15 mph speed limit would support the City’s goal of creating safer streets for children in school zones, as lowering speeds in these areas is proven to reduce both the likelihood and severity of collisions for all road users. We encourage everyone to take part in improving safety for children commuting to and from school by reducing their speed and staying alert on the road. *Police Chief Welcomes New Leadership on Chief’s Advisory Committee*
The Chief’s Advisory Committee was established in 2018 to provide community members with direct access to the Police Chief on issues related to the department. This includes development of community policing concepts, increasing public awareness, and providing neutral, third-party insight to be considered in the department’s decision-making process. The committee in intended to represent a wide cross-section of community viewpoints and interests concerning the protection, service and public safety needs and will consist of the following residents and business owners: Julie Armer Turner, Jill Brooks, Dana Caldwell, Azizul Choudbury, Yvonne Inciarte, Sherry Johnson, Leslie Kelsay, Chris Mavrakis, Paul Raineri, Ujjal Singh, Moksha Smith, Steve Souza, Kaushal Varshney, John Wardell and Bill Wolfe. Free Disposal Day
*Free Disposal Day:* Start the New Year off with less clutter around your home! Santa Clara’s next Free Disposal Day will be held on Saturday, Jan. 18, 2025, from 6 a.m. to noon at the Mission Trail Waste Systems (MTWS) Transfer Station. Free Disposal Day provides residents an opportunity to dispose of appliances and e-waste items, as well as mattresses, furniture, and other bulky items at no cost. *To participate, call MTWS at 408-727-5365 between Jan. 6 - 17 to make an appointment and for details on location, load size limits and accepted/non-accepted materials.* Proof of residency (utility bill or driver’s license) is required and residents are responsible for unloading their vehicles.
Household Hazardous Waste Drop-off Event
*Household Hazardous Waste Drop-off Event:* Did you know that the holiday season generates a lot of household hazardous waste (HHW)? Electronic toys, batteries, and holiday lights are considered HHW and should never be placed in your garbage bin. Safely dispose of these items at our free drop-off event on Saturday, Jan. 25, 2025 in Santa Clara. This is also the perfect opportunity to get rid of old paint, chemical cleaners, pesticides, fluorescent lamps, medications, sharps, and other hazardous waste materials. Appointments are required. To schedule an appointment, contact the County Household Hazardous Waste Program at 408-299-7300 or visit *hhw.org [ https://hhw.santaclaracounty.gov/home ]*.
